C# Class Gallatin.Core.Service.AccessLogContract

Inheritance: IAccessLog
Show file Open project: williamoneill/Gallatin

Public Methods

Method Description
Start ( DirectoryInfo logDirectory ) : void
Stop ( ) : void
Write ( string connectionId, IHttpRequest request, AccessLogType logType ) : void

Method Details

Start() public method

public Start ( DirectoryInfo logDirectory ) : void
logDirectory System.IO.DirectoryInfo
return void

Stop() public abstract method

public abstract Stop ( ) : void
return void

Write() public method

public Write ( string connectionId, IHttpRequest request, AccessLogType logType ) : void
connectionId string
request IHttpRequest
logType AccessLogType
return void